How they compare
Armenia currently reports 2,656 against 2,520 in Bolivia, a difference of 136.
That makes Armenia's figure about 1.1 times Bolivia's.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 6 shared years of data; in 2016 it was Bolivia ahead.
Armenia ranks 60th and Bolivia ranks 61st of 98 countries.
Across the 2 decades both report, Armenia averaged higher in 1 and Bolivia in 1.
